Nagpur's MIHAN Gets ₹1,200 Crore Mixed-Use Hub by VIPL
A massive ₹1,200 crore mixed-use project is coming to MIHAN, Nagpur. VIPL Infrastructure will build commercial towers, NMRDA's new HQ, and residential blocks.

Project Details
VIPL Infrastructure will develop a DBFOS (Design, Build, Finance, Operate, Transfer) mixed-use complex. The total investment is ₹1,200 crore, with a 48-month construction timeline.
Location
The hub is situated at Sondapar within MIHAN (Maharashtra International Airport and SEZ area) in Nagpur. This is a key growth corridor for the city.
Regulatory & Timeline
The project is awarded by NMRDA (Nagpur Metropolitan Region Development Authority). The DBFOS model involves private financing and operation before transfer. Completion is targeted in 4 years.

What actually happened?
The Nagpur Metropolitan Region Development Authority (NMRDA) has officially awarded a massive project to VIPL Infrastructure. The contract is for a mixed-use hub at Sondapar in MIHAN.
The project is valued at ₹1,200 crore and follows the DBFOS model, meaning the private developer will design, build, finance, and operate it before transferring it back.
- Developer: VIPL Infrastructure
- Authority: NMRDA
- Model: DBFOS (Design, Build, Finance, Operate, Transfer)
- Investment: ₹1,200 crore
